Barrier and Regulation Standards

All residential pools in BC, including hybrid models, must meet strict pool fencing regulations. These include a tall non-climbable fence with secure gates, positioned at least 1 meter from doors leading outside. The goal is to prevent accidental pet access. Distance Limits Near Riparian Zones

If your property borders a lake, creek, or wetland, you must follow additional buffer rules under BC’s Riparian Areas Regulation. Typically, pools must be set back at least 16–50 feet from the high-water mark, depending on shoreline sensitivity. These rules protect natural ecosystems and minimize runoff contamination. A pool site evaluation by a certified pool technician ensures your hybrid installation stays compliant.

Maintenance and Winterization for Your Hybrid Pool

Ongoing Maintenance Essentials

Maintain optimal function all year with consistent filtration checks. Semi in-ground pools need weekly attention to pH, chlorine, and alkalinity levels—especially after heavy use or rain. A certified pool technician can help set up automated systems or scheduled visits to manage pool filtration systems effortlessly and safely.

Best Practices for Cold Weather

Safely anchoring your seasonal tarp prevents debris, ice damage, and accidents. Use a strong cover designed for hybrid models, and ensure it’s tightly fastened with water bags or anchors. Avoid letting snow accumulate, and consider a ice prevention tool to reduce strain. A well-protected pool means easier spring startup later.
